Topic: Movement

Movement is the ability of living organisms to move from one place to another.

Reasons for Movement

  1. To search for food
  2. To escape from danger
  3.  To respond to a stimulus either positively or negatively
  4. For the sake of reproduction

CYCLOSIS

Cyclosis or cytoplasmic streaming: This is the mass rotational streaming or movement of the cytoplasm and its contents in cells with the vacuole. In some cases, the streaming may be restricted to a particular region or the cell while at times the whole cytoplasm is subjected to cyclical movement of the cell.

 

S/N ORGANISMS ORGANELLE FOR MOVEMENT  MECHANISM OF MOVEMENT 
1 Amoeba  Pseudopodia  Cytoplasmic 
2 Paramecium Cillia Beating the cilia against water
3 Euglena   Flagellum  Lashing movement of the flagellum 
4 Hydra Tentacles  Swimming, swaying, hopping and somersaulting 
5 Earthworm  Chaetae Crawling 
6 Fishes Fins Swimming 
7 Toads and frogs Limbs Hopping
